怎么优化oracle数据库

优化Oracle数据库可以通过以下方式进行:数据库设计优化:确保数据库表结构合理,避免重复数据和冗余字段,使用适当的数据类型和索引等。查询优化:编写高效的SQL查询语句,避免使用通配符查询和不必要的连接查询,尽量避免全表扫描。索引优化:创建合适的索引以加快查询速度,避免过多索引导致性能下降,定期检查索引的使用情况并进行优化。统计信息优化:定期收集表和索引的统计信息,以帮助Oracle优化查询

优化Oracle数据库可以通过以下方式进行:

  1. 数据库设计优化:确保数据库表结构合理,避免重复数据和冗余字段,使用适当的数据类型和索引等。

  2. 查询优化:编写高效的SQL查询语句,避免使用通配符查询和不必要的连接查询,尽量避免全表扫描。

  3. 索引优化:创建合适的索引以加快查询速度,避免过多索引导致性能下降,定期检查索引的使用情况并进行优化。

  4. 统计信息优化:定期收集表和索引的统计信息,以帮助Oracle优化查询计划。

  5. 内存优化:调整内存参数,如SGA和PGA的大小,以提高数据库性能和响应速度。

  6. IO优化:合理分配磁盘空间、使用RAID等技术提高IO性能,避免频繁的磁盘IO操作。

  7. 优化数据库配置参数:根据实际需求调整Oracle数据库的各项配置参数,以提高数据库性能。

  8. 监控和调优:定期监控数据库性能和进行调优,及时发现和解决潜在的性能问题。

通过以上方式对Oracle数据库进行优化,可以提高数据库性能和稳定性,提升用户体验和系统效率。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/1000963.html

(0)
派派
上一篇 2024-04-22
下一篇 2024-04-22

相关推荐

  • java怎么读取服务器上的文件

    要读取服务器上的文件,可以使用Java的Socket类与服务器建立连接,并发送请求来读取文件。以下是一个简单的示例代码:import java.io.BufferedReader;import java.io.IOException;import java.io.InputStreamReader;import java.net.Socket;public class FileClient

    2024-04-18
    0
  • Flink任务调度器是怎么工作的

    Flink任务调度器是Flink作业执行引擎中的一个重要组件,负责管理作业的执行流程和调度任务的执行顺序。其工作流程如下:接收作业提交请求:当用户提交一个作业到Flink集群时,任务调度器会接收到作业提交请求,并根据作业的需求和配置进行相应的初始化工作。构建作业图:任务调度器会根据作业的逻辑结构和依赖关系,构建出作业图。作业图表示了作业中各个算子之间的依赖关系,以及数据流向。任务调度器会根据作业图

    2024-03-22
    0
  • OpenNMS是否支持对网络流量进行实时分析和可视化

    是的,OpenNMS支持对网络流量进行实时分析和可视化。它提供了实时监控功能,可以监控网络流量的实时情况,并根据预先设定的规则进行分析和报警。用户可以通过OpenNMS的Dashboard功能查看实时流量数据,并通过图表、图形等可视化方式进行分析。同时,OpenNMS还提供了各种报表和统计功能,帮助用户更好地了解网络流量情况。

    2024-04-24
    0
  • centos卸载docker的方法是什么

    要卸载Docker在CentOS上,可以按照以下步骤进行操作:停止和删除所有正在运行的容器:sudo docker stop $(sudo docker ps -a -q)sudo docker rm $(sudo docker ps -a -q)删除所有的镜像:sudo docker rmi $(sudo docker images -q)卸载Docker软件包:sudo yum remove

    2024-03-05
    0
  • 广推宝是一个什么平台(推广平台都有什么)

    广推宝是一个什么平台,推广平台都有什么内容导航:推广宝网络有限公司是干什么的刷单销量任务平台是真的吗商喜广推宝是不是骗人的广富宝这样的平台未来的发展前景会如何一、推广宝网络有限公司是干什么的推广宝网络有限公司服务范围:全国企事业单位互联网应用服务、网络推广、代发广告信息、网络营销、电子商务的应用,品牌策划等推广领域。如果还需要深入了解,建议你可以去看看他们公司的百科。希望我的回答

    2022-04-15
    0
  • Java原型模式指的是什么

    Java原型模式指的是一种创建对象的设计模式,它通过复制现有对象来创建新的对象,而不是通过使用构造函数创建新的对象。原型模式在需要创建多个相似对象时非常有用,它可以提高对象创建的效率。通过使用原型模式,可以避免重复执行复杂的实例化过程,而只需要复制一个已有对象的数据即可。在Java中,原型模式通常通过实现Cloneable接口来实现对象的复制。

    2024-01-22
    0

发表回复

登录后才能评论